Software update data back up problems

Hi, 
So I've just got around to updating my 9360 to what I think is 7.1
After I deleted the unused languages and created space for it, the phone started a data back up But when it got to 15% it just stopped and didn't move, I left it all evening (so about 4hrs) and still nothing, so I turned it off and took the battery out. I put it back in again and the back up started again, but this time it got to 8% and stopped , I left it over night but nothing. 
Any ideas? Because the phone is rendered useless until this is finished. Oh and also, I've tried plugging it in to mycomputer to updatethrough the software but obviously it won't connect
Thanks, Tim

There are two methods of recovery for you to try:
One:
Open Blackberry Desktop Software & Connect your device with PC using USB cable, without inserting battery.
You will get three option Retry, Update Or Cancel, then click on update.
Once it is to the stage of the update "initializing handheld", then insert battery.
If this does not work, and you remain stuck on the backing up the Social Feeds database, go to the second method below.
Secondly:
Start your BlackBerry in Safe mode.  Article ID: KB17877 How to start a BlackBerry smartphone in Safe Modehttp://www.blackberry.com/btsc/KB17877
Connect to the BlackBerry Desktop Software and allow your handheld to connect. If you are prompted to upgrade, cancel the upgrade for later.
IF you cannot connect or your Desktop Software does not recognize your device while in Safe Mode, please follow the directions here to force the detect:  Article ID: KB10144 How to force the detection of the BlackBerry smartphone using Application Loader
Go to Device > delete > SELECT DATA > select to delete both the Social Feeds and Smart Card databases, and follow the remaining prompts to complete it. 
Now, you can return and click to upgrade the device through the Desktop Manager, or reboot the BlackBerry in normal mode and continue the over the air upgrade.

  • Hard Drive warning when upgrading to Mountain Lion. 2 try and I was able to upgrade. Software update for IPhoto, had problems restarting. Do I need my hard drive checked

    Hard Drive warning when upgrading to Mountain Lion. 2nd try and I was able to upgrade. Software update for IPhoto, had problems restarting. Do I need my hard drive checked

    Yes.
    Choose Apple menu > Restart. Hold down the Command (⌘) and R keys as your computer restarts.
    When you see a white screen with an Apple logo in the middle, you can release the keys.
    Click Disk Utility, and then click Continue.
    In the list at the left, select the item you want to repair. (Be sure to select an item that’s indented to the right in the list, not an item at the far left.)
    Click First Aid.
    If Disk Utility tells you the disk is about to fail, back it up and replace it. You can’t repair it.
    Click Repair Disk.
    If Disk Utility reports that the disk appears to be OK or has been repaired, you’re done.
    Otherwise, you may need to do one of the following steps.
    If Disk Utility can’t repair your disk or it reports “The underlying task reported failure,” try to repair the disk or partition again. If that doesn’t work, back up as much of your data as possible, reformat the disk, reinstall Mac OS X, and then restore your backed-up data.
    If you continue to have problems with your disk, it may be physically damaged and need to be replaced

  • SCCM - Software update roll back

    Hi All,
    CAn some one share step -by step guide to roll back the deployed software updates.
    Regards,

    To put it at a high level:
    - Find the uninstall string/command-line for an update (not all updates can necessarily be uninstalled though)
    - Create an empty package with a single program containing that uninstall string/command-line
    - Advertise that program to the desired systems
    The above is scriptable so that you really just create a script that you put in a package and program and then advertise that finds the appropriate uninstall command-line for an update and then runs it. I think a few folks have example scripts like
    this posted on their websites (like ccmexec.org).
    Ultimately though, there's nothing built in for this as Garth pointed out.

  • Mac os x server software update data location

    Does anyone know how to change the data location of Mac OS X Server (v3) Software Update?
    I'd like to move it to a large RAID permanently connected to the server but I can't find the command in serveradmin.
    Cheers,
    Kirk

    Why not move the whole boot disk and Serve.app and the rest out to the RAID array?  It's not like OS X is that big a hunk lately in comparison with the size of various RAID arrays, and relocating the whole configuration means you won't have to deal with a piecemeal relocation, nor any future upgrade weirdnesses that might arise from the relocation.
    That approach aside, Mavericks Server storage is mostly under the /Library/Server path.  I haven't tried relocating indidual hunks yet, either.
    Ah, slightly misread...  You could shut off Software Update entirely, and use Reposado.  That'll let you do what you want. 
    The other hunk you'd probably want to move is the Caching Server.
